Output 16ba85c93da170cd2c4926ff7d95011ffbb9e8e97ea23a7ff32344c5c6610784:1

value
26754
script pubkey
OP_0 OP_PUSHBYTES_20 2e0bba12488f9a1da93a2573177e0a5280cc8db6
address
bc1q9c9m5yjg37dpm2f6y4e3wls222qverdk5scphg
transaction
16ba85c93da170cd2c4926ff7d95011ffbb9e8e97ea23a7ff32344c5c6610784
confirmations
1272
spent
false